控制台应用程序-打印图形
创建控制台应用程序,在点击项目右键添加-新建项-类命名为:Program,详细代码如下:
using System;namespace Text_09_15graphical
{class Program{static void Main(string[] args){Console.WriteLine("打印三角形");for (int i = 0; i < 10; i++){for (int j = 0; j < 2 * i - 1; j++){Console.Write("*");}Console.WriteLine();}Console.WriteLine("打印反转的三角形");for (int i = 0; i < 10; i++){for (int j = 10; j > 2 * i - 1; j--){Console.Write("*");}Console.WriteLine();}Console.WriteLine("打印等腰三角形");{for (int i = 0; i < 10; i++){for (int k = 0; k < 10 - i; k++){Console.Write(" ");}for (int j = 0; j < 2 * i + 1; j++){Console.Write("*");}Console.WriteLine();}}Console.WriteLine("打印圣诞树");for (int n = 1; n < 7; n++){for (int i = 1; i <= n; i++){for (int k = 0; k < 10 - i; k++){Console.Write(" ");}for (int j = 0; j < 2 * i - 1; j++){Console.Write("*");}Console.WriteLine();}}Console.WriteLine("打印菱形");for (int i = 1; i < 5; i++){for (int j = 1; j <= 5 - i; j++){Console.Write(" ");}for (int k = 1; k <= 2 * i - 1; k++){Console.Write("*");}Console.WriteLine();}for (int i = 5; i >= 1; i--){for (int j = 1; j <= 5 - i; j++){Console.Write(" ");}for (int k = 1; k <= 2 * i - 1; k++){Console.Write("*");}Console.WriteLine();}Console.WriteLine("打印汉字");for (int i = 0; i < 10; i++){for (int k = 0; k < 10; k++){Console.Write(" ");}for (int j = 0; j < 10; j++){if (i == 0 || i == 9 || j == 0 || j == 9){Console.Write("*");}else{Console.Write(" ");}}Console.WriteLine();}for (int i = 0; i < 10; i++){for (int k = 0; k < 10; k++){Console.Write(" ");}for (int j = 0; j < 10; j++){if (i == 0 || i == 9 || j == 0 || j == 9 || i == 4 || j == 4){Console.Write("*");}else{Console.Write(" ");}}Console.WriteLine();}}}
}
结果:
控制台应用程序-打印图形相关推荐
- C#控制台应用程序打印“我爱你”
using System; using System.Collections; using System.Collections.Generic; using System.IO; using Sys ...
- php打印倒立金字塔,编写程序打印*字符形成的等腰三角形倒立金字塔图形 ******* ***** *** *...
导航:网站首页 > 编写程序打印*字符形成的等腰三角形倒立金字塔图形 ******* ***** *** * 编写程序打印*字符形成的等腰三角形倒立金字塔图形 ******* ***** *** ...
- 解决windows 10英文版操作系统中VS2017控制台程序打印中文乱码问题
当您在windows 10英文版的操作系统中运行Vs2017控制台应用程序时,程序可能无法正常显示中文,中文都变成了乱码.这是由于大部分中文程序所使用的文字编码与Windows 英文系统的文字编码不同 ...
- c语言打印字母金字塔图形,C程序打印金字塔和图案
C程序打印金字塔和图案 在此示例中,您将学习在C语言编程中打印半金字塔,倒金字塔,全金字塔,倒全金字塔,帕斯卡三角形和弗洛伊德三角形. 要理解此示例,您应该了解以下C语言编程主题: 这是您在此页面中找 ...
- c语言如何打印矩形图形的程序 五行七列,C语言程序计 第二讲.printf打印图形.转义字符.格式声明符.doc...
白匿潮抛辣胖嫡隅费唤激百努弱兢终秃疵褪沉硝脊逆躁剪帕份谍契氟栖概更羊劣租砾纳丸酬革峭泌惊淡橡巩席索庇豫疥屿愿点红星湾叉淤儒途童煤堵挽淘影碾轻霜秩隐憋昆躇笔员肌插驾宠炙彻抛负洞匝谓羚颠荧红魏赦严宛骏按氯 ...
- 2018年第九届省赛C/C++A组第5题——打印图形
标题:打印图形 如下的程序会在控制台绘制分形图(就是整体与局部自相似的图形). 当n=1,2,3的时候,输出如下: 请仔细分析程序,并填写划线部分缺少的代码. #include <stdio.h ...
- LQ0122 等腰三角形【打印图形】
题目来源:蓝桥杯2018初赛 C++ C组H题 题目描述 本题目要求你在控制台输出一个由数字组成的等腰三角形. 具体的步骤是: 先用1,2,3,-的自然数拼一个足够长的串 用这个串填充三角形的三条边. ...
- 如何在C#Windows控制台应用程序中更新当前行?
使用C#构建Windows控制台应用程序时,是否可以在不扩展当前行或转到新行的情况下写入控制台? 例如,如果我想显示一个百分比,该百分比代表一个过程到完成为止的距离,我只想在与光标相同的行上更新值,而 ...
- 屏蔽控制台应用程序的窗口#pragma comment(linker, /subsystem:windows /ENTRY:mainCRTStartup)...
众所周知,控制台应用程序一般都会显示一个控制台窗口(虚拟DOS窗口),但很多时候控制台程序的执行逻辑根本不需要与用户进行交互,所以显示这个难看的窗口纯属多余,那么如何将它屏蔽掉呢?下面我向大家介绍一种 ...
最新文章
- 4 RACMulticastConnection 连接类
- 20170608-BOM
- wkhtmltopdf
- JavaScript学习总结(六)——JavaScript判断数据类型总结
- “约见”面试官系列之常见面试题第十四篇之所有数据类型(建议收藏)
- CentOS6.4安装包初识
- 作业帮:最长连续序列(头部插入)
- Asp.Net中自以为是的Encode
- WebAPI——cookie与session遇到的问题
- [转载] python bp神经网络 mnist_Python利用全连接神经网络求解MNIST问题详解
- UnsatisfiedDependencyException
- 2022年数据分析与可视化10大案例总结
- DDR3的容量计算方法
- 重装系统后开机启动项菜单如何删除
- 先验 超验_经验、先验、超验
- 图灵测试其实已经过时了
- 基于开路电压+安时积分法估算锂电池SOC(二)
- Remix OS——一个很有魅力的Android系统
- 简单的Android XML布局使用
- 宏录制流程——例:生成工资条